随着数字化浪潮的不断推进,区块链技术逐渐成为了现代经济体系中不可忽视的一部分。区块链以其去中心化、透明和不可篡改的特性,吸引了各行各业的关注。从最初的比特币崛起,到如今的各种链式应用,区块链已经渗透到金融、供应链、医疗等多个领域。本文旨在深入探讨数字区块链的运行机制,帮助读者更好地理解这一前沿技术。
#### 数字区块链的基本概念数字区块链是由一系列按照时间顺序相连的区块组成的去中心化数据库。每个区块包含若干条交易记录,并通过加密技术确保数据的安全性与完整性。与传统的中心化数据库不同,区块链不依赖于单一的管理机构,而是由网络中所有参与节点共同维护,使得其具有良好的抗审查能力与数据透明性。
区块链的构成主要包括交易、区块和链。交易是信息传递的基础,多个交易被打包成区块,再通过按顺序连接形成区块链。每个区块中都包含了前一个区块的哈希值,从而确保了数据的连贯性和不可篡改性。
#### 数字区块链的运行机制区块链的运行机制核心在于去中心化架构。传统系统依赖于中心节点进行管理,而区块链网络中的每个节点都有平等的权利参与数据的验证与记录。节点的数量和分布使得数据更为安全,减少了单点故障的风险。
数据的存储和传输是区块链技术的关键所在。交易信息通过P2P网络广播给所有节点,节点通过验证交易的合法性,形成一个共识。交易被确认后,加入到新的区块中,再存储在区块链上。这一过程不仅提高了数据的安全性,还有助于提升处理效率。
#### 共识机制的种类与比较共识机制是区块链技术的心脏,它决定了网络的运行效率及安全性。工作量证明(PoW)是一种需要消耗大量计算资源的机制,适用于比特币等激烈竞争的区块链。但它的高能耗问题引发了广泛的争论。
权益证明(PoS)作为一种新兴的共识机制,通过持有代币的数量及持有时间来决定节点的权益,从而减少能耗和提升效率。此外,还有代表权证明(DPoS)等其他共识机制,以期在治理和安全之间实现更好的平衡。
#### 智能合约与区块链的结合智能合约是区块链技术的重要应用之一,可以设定合约条款的自动执行。其核心原理是在区块链平台上编写代码,以自动化执行合同的各项条款,降低信任成本和交易费用。
当前,智能合约广泛应用于金融、保险等领域,通过去中心化保证合约的执行与安全性。在以太坊等平台,开发者可以构建复杂的应用程序,使得区块链的应用更加多样化。
#### 区块链技术的应用领域区块链技术的应用领域非常广泛,尤其在金融领域,通过去中心化来提高交易透明度和降低交易成本。同时,在供应链管理中,区块链有效地追踪产品来源,确保商品的真实性和可靠性。
医疗领域的数字身份管理可以利用区块链技术确保患者数据的安全与隐私。未来,区块链还将在公共服务、知识产权等多个领域展现出巨大的潜力。
#### 区块链技术的挑战与未来展望尽管区块链技术前景广阔,但仍面临着各种挑战,特别是扩展性问题取得更大进展仍然是其主要障碍。此外,合规性和法律问题也需要得到更好的解决,以确保技术的合法应用。
展望未来,区块链技术将进一步融合AI、物联网等技术,推动智能城市、数字经济的发展。随着技术的成熟,区块链有望在改变社会及经济格局上发挥重要作用。
#### 总结总结来说,数字区块链的运行机制在去中心化、高效性及安全性方面具有独特优势。随着技术的不断发展和应用案例的增加,区块链将在未来继续发挥其重要作用,为各行各业带来深刻变革。
如果有其他问题,也可以补充讨论,例如对某个特定领域应用的深入分析等。
leave a reply